If you’re considering a move to the southeastern part of Norfolk, VA, Coronado is a charming neighborhood that offers a wonderful blend of suburban tranquility and vibrant community life. Known for its tree-lined streets and a variety of architectural styles, this area is perfect for those seeking a peaceful yet engaging place to call home. Coronado boasts an active neighborhood association that organizes events and fosters a strong sense of community, making it easy for newcomers to connect and feel at home quickly. The neighborhood’s parks and green spaces provide ample opportunities for outdoor activities, which is a real plus for families and outdoor enthusiasts alike.

One of the standout features of Coronado is its proximity to several local attractions and amenities that enhance daily living. Residents enjoy easy access to the beautiful Lafayette River, which is perfect for kayaking, paddleboarding, or simply enjoying scenic waterfront views. The neighborhood is also close to the Norfolk Botanical Garden, a must-visit spot for nature lovers, offering spectacular floral displays and seasonal events. For those who appreciate local culture and shopping, the nearby Ghent district offers a plethora of dining options, boutiques, and art galleries, all just a short drive away. Coronado combines the best of suburban comfort with the convenience of nearby urban attractions.

Getting to Downtown Norfolk from Coronado is quick and hassle-free, typically taking about 10 to 15 minutes by car. This makes it an excellent neighborhood for professionals who work downtown but prefer to live in a quieter, more residential setting. Public transportation options are also available, providing additional flexibility for commuters. Whether you’re drawn by the peaceful streets, the vibrant community spirit, or the close proximity to both natural and cultural landmarks, Coronado offers a welcoming and dynamic environment for those relocating to Norfolk.

Housing trends offer valuable insight into the accessibility and character of a neighborhood. In Coronado, the median home price is $183,433, which is less than many surrounding areas. This affordability makes it an attractive option for first-time buyers, young families, or anyone looking to enter the housing market without a significant financial barrier. Looking at appreciation rates and past market trends in Coronado can offer valuable insight into the neighborhood’s investment potential. Understanding how home values have changed over time helps buyers gauge future growth, assess long-term stability, and make more informed real estate decisions.

The median rent is around $1,238, which is on par with many comparable neighborhoods. This balanced pricing offers a mix of affordability and value, making it a practical choice for a wide range of renters.
